Here, her steely gaze brilliantly nails the baffled and baffling emotions of teenagers on the verge of adulthood.” — The Seattle Times   “French…writes beautifully.” — The Boston Globe   “ The Secret Place is an absorbing take on a hot subgenre by one of our most skillful suspense novelists.” — Popmatters.com   “[Tana French] simply nails it…I just could not put it down!” — BookPage Informationen zum Autor Tana French  is also the author of  In the Woods ,  The Likeness ,  Faithful Place ,  Broken Harbor  and  The Secret Place . Her books have won awards including the Edgar, Anthony, Macavity, and Barry awards, the  Los Angeles Times  Award for Best Mystery/Thriller, and the Irish Book Award for Crime Fiction.
